运维

运维

Products

当前位置:首页 > 运维 >

Ubuntu上Golang编译失败怎么办?有妙招吗?

96SEO 2025-05-14 10:58 2


深厚入解析Golang编译错误及优化策略

在Golang开发过程中,编译错误是程序员三天两头会遇到的问题。这些个错误兴许源于代码语法、编译选项、依赖库等许多种因素。本文将深厚入琢磨Golang编译错误的成因,并给相应的优化策略,以帮开发者解决这些个问题。

1. Golang编译错误背景及关系到

Golang是一种高大效、 静态类型的编程语言,广泛应用于网络编程和后端开发领域。只是即使是经验丰有钱的Golang程序员,也困难免会遇到编译错误。这些个错误兴许会关系到项目的进度,少许些开发效率。

Ubuntu中Golang编译失败怎么办

2. Golang编译错误的典型表现和产生原因

在Golang开发过程中, 常见的编译错误包括代码语法错误、未定义的变量、编译选项错误等。

2.1 代码语法错误

Golang编译器对代码的语法要求非常严格, 常见的语法错误包括括号不匹配、语句不完整、函数调用参数错误等。

2.2 未定义的变量

如果在代码中用了一个未定义的变量,编译器会报出“

2.3 编译选项错误

在用 go build 等命令编译时兴许会基本上原因是用了错误的编译选项而弄得错误。比方说-mthreads 选项在有些情况下兴许不被识别。

3. 针对Golang编译错误的优化策略

为了解决Golang编译错误, 我们能从以下维度提出优化策略:

3.1 代码审查

通过代码审查,能及时找到和修优良代码中的语法错误和潜在问题。这有助于搞优良代码质量,少许些编译错误的发生。

3.2 用版本管理工具

用版本管理工具来管理不同版本的Golang,并确保当前用的版本与项目兼容。这有助于避免因版本不兼容弄得的编译错误。

3.3 查阅官方文档和社区材料

在遇到编译错误时 能查阅Golang官方文档和社区材料,了解相关错误的原因和优良决方案。这有助于飞迅速定位问题,搞优良问题解决效率。

3.4 用IDE和代码编辑器

用集成开发周围或代码编辑器进行Golang开发。这些个工具通常给了代码补全、语法检查、错误提示等功能,有助于少许些编译错误的发生。

4. 与觉得能

通过实施上述优化策略, 能有效解决Golang编译错误,搞优良开发效率。在实际项目中,应根据具体业务场景和需求,选择合适的优化策略组合。一边,建立持续的性能监控体系,确保系统始终保持最优状态。


标签: ubuntu

提交需求或反馈

Demand feedback